Transaction 78ad3009b56d5a2834406c7b2d5874412d50ec21d4309b91a9576947b9325fe3

block
b6927bcaa63fa819aa0fa7f3bbc82de2b3dcd8a85a07ddd0c20e59b0caee965b

1 Input

23 Outputs